The size of Wanguri is approximately 0.9 square kilometres. It has 10 parks covering nearly 10.4% of total area. The population of Wanguri in 2016 was 1876 people. By 2021 the population was 1836 showing a population decline of 2.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Wanguri is 40-49 years. Households in Wanguri are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Wanguri work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 66.40% of the homes in Wanguri were owner-occupied compared with 68.10% in 2016.
